How to Remember Everything: Grades 9-12 teaches high school students HOW to learn. Instead of providing them with long lists of information, we teach students memory tricks and techniques for learning large amounts of information quickly and easily--so that students can remember that information for years to come. Rote memorization doesn't result in long-term memory retention--but creative learning does. Teachers and students can use these mnemonic devices to produce both short-term and long-term memory.
Designed in full-color with illustrations throughout, this incredible learning resource is also easy to use and highly accessible. Includes more than 200 clever mnemonics for English, Social Studies, Math and Science.
